D | Traveled in October

The tour Irish Highlights was excellent. I wish the tour lasted a week longer. Neil and Stevie were the best. Schedules, timing and interesting places to see and do were fantastic. Neil provided information to prepare us for places we were to visit and was very knowledgeable. The coach was perfectly clean. Optional tours were fantastic. The tour guide went out of his way to facilitate us having alit of fun and help us if needed, re food choice, answering questions, joining in sing a longs etc. The accommodations were good locationsThe only thing that bothered me was that there was a large group of people who constantly used the bus wc before and after every stop instead of using restrooms off the bus. It seemed that they were constantly up and down the aisle. I believe the two Trafalgar tours I have done were equally excellent, the guides and drivers were excellent and I will do another Trafalgar tour. I highly recommend Trafalgar.

Anonymous | Traveled in October

This itinerary had a nice mix of seeing irelands countryside, seeing tourist destinations, a touch of local sites, and free time to explore on our own.Tamara was kind and knowledgeable. We were impressed with Stevie’s driving and knew he would keep us safe. I also appreciate their daily planning to get us to crowded sites before it became crowded. Our only negative on the trip was our flight booked by Trafalgar was cancelled by Aer Lingus. Trafalgar was unable to help us with changing our flights. We booked a new flight ourselves and arrived in time for the bus tour to start but we missed our tour of Dublin and we paid for a hotel room we never were in.
